Chief of Army Staff witnesses Army Polo Championship Finals

Rawalpindi, January 05, 2014 (PPI-OT): The spectators were treated to a fine brand of Polo during Army Polo Championship Finals held at Lahore Garrison Polo ground. Chief of Army Staff, General Raheel Sharif, was the Chief Guest and awarded prizes to the winners of Army Polo and Tent Pegging Championship.

The Rawalpindi Zone knocked Peshawar Zone to runners up position in the stunning finals and took the elusive title of 2013 champions after an invigorating contest which ended with 5 1/2 to 5. Third spot was claimed by Mangla Zone, winning the day’s earlier fixture by 6 1/2 goals to 3 ahead of Rawalpindi B team.

The final could not have been a more fierce fight between two incredible teams, Rawalpindi Zone and Peshawar Zone. The players and ponies jostled for the lead continuously with each taking their turn at the top. In the end it all came to a head in the last chukkar when Maj Gen Asfandyar Padauti scored a spectacular goal with the back hander taking Rawalpindi Zone’s score to 5 1/2 goals, just 1/2 goal ahead of Peshawar Zone and secured victory and 2013 title for this consistently high quality team.

This is the second time they have stood atop of the podium at the Army Polo Championship. Team of Rawalpindi Zone received the Army Polo Championships trophy, while Captain Naeem, Team captain of Gujranwala Zone received the Army Tent Pegging Trophy.

Earlier, the spectators were enthralled by equestrian games. The remarkable horsemanship by Army Tent Peggers, a brilliant horse dancing show and tilting tunes of Army band added colour to the concluding ceremony of week-long Army Polo and Tent Pegging Championship.
